Steam is chock-full with free games, and it’s tough to navigate whether they’re worth your time, or just throwing into your library.

This is where it’s worth listening to other players, who take to Steam to review games, and help us decide if they’re worth starting.

Given a 10/10 by fans, this Steam game might be worth a look

Lunacid - Tears of the Moon, is a surprise free game, and I’ll admit I know nothing about it beyond what’s listed on the Steam page.

A first-person dungeon crawler, Lunacid is built using the Sword of Moonlight - King’s Field tool, and expands stories laid out from 25 years ago.

The game’s creator notes that players will “Explore various dungeons for powerful weapons and spells to forestall the previsioned end of the world.”

Taking players into the kingdom of Lyria, you will play as Calamis who has received a vision of the end of the world.

A Great Old One is slumbering beneath the earth and will soon plunge the world into darkness - it’s only by exploring and finding powerful weapons that you can avert danger.

Fans are quick to review the game and sing its praises.

“Having played through the game in its entirety, I've got to say I only have one real gripe; I wish there was more!” exclaims one player.

“Absolutely stellar,” notes another fan, after finishing the game.

It certainly sounds like a big hit with fans, although many note that it’s quite clunky, but that could be by design, given it’s based on a 25 year old engine.

One user has given Lunacid a perfect score, saying, “10/10. Love the story and it is a nice Prequel to Lunacid, the fact something like this is free is mind boggling to me.”

Clocking in at around six hours of play, this seems a lovely little game to pass an evening and introduce you to the series.
